夜神模拟器无法使用 https://support.microsoft.com/en-us/help/4526424/windows-10-driver-cant-load-on-this-device Memory integrity You are receiving this message
转载 2020-06-15 13:15:00
1520阅读
2评论
1                         Device Driver中常用的Physcial Memory Allocating的方法 在device
转载 2024-05-13 18:41:38
375阅读
Linux是Unix操作系统的一种变种,在Linux下编写驱动程序的原理和思想完全类似于其他的Unix系统,但它dos或window环境下的驱动程序有很大的区别。在Linux环境下设计驱动程序,思想简洁,操作方便,功能也很强大,但是支持函数少,只能依赖kernel中的函数,有些常用的操作要自己来编写,而且调试也不方便。本人这几周来为实验室自行研制的一块多媒体卡编制了驱动程序,获得了一些经验,愿
转载 精选 2012-12-03 15:48:47
300阅读
Linux device drivers are essential components of the Linux operating system, allowing various hardware devices to communicate with the kernel and other system components. One popular tool for developi
原创 2024-03-11 11:58:52
22阅读
首先介绍一下注册一个驱动的步骤:1、定义一个platform_driver结构2、初始化这个结构,指定其probe、remove等函数,并初始化其中的driver变量3、实现其probe、remove等函数看platform_driver结构,定义于include/linux/platform_device.h文件中:struct platform_driver { int (*probe
转载 2023-07-13 20:24:16
96阅读
1.Spark JVM参数优化设置Spark JVM的参数优化设置适用于Spark的所有模块,包括SparkSQL、SparkStreaming、SparkRdd及SparkML,主要设置以下几个值:spark.yarn.driver.memoryOverhead #driver端最大的堆内存,设置为driverMemory*0.1,不小于384m spark.yarn.excutor.memo
转载 2023-08-27 23:45:02
570阅读
## 如何设置 Spark Driver Memory ### 1. 简介 在使用 Apache Spark 进行大数据处理时,"Spark Driver Memory" 是一个非常重要的参数。Spark Driver 是 Spark 应用程序的主进程,负责管理和协调整个应用程序的执行过程。而 Spark Driver Memory 则是用来指定 Spark Driver 进程使用的内存大小。
原创 2024-01-16 11:32:38
231阅读
我们在项目中更换了DRAM,所以需要重新配置S3C6410的DRAM控制器,结果发现S3C6410中的DRAM控制器还是挺复杂的。  S3C6410支持两个DRAM片选,可以分别接最大256MB的内存,该处理器用的DRAM控制器是来自ARM的PrimeCell Dynamic Memory Controller(PL340)。只看S3C6410的Datasheet中的DRAM部
转载 2024-07-08 06:51:33
49阅读
从 Linux 2.6 起引入了一套新的驱动管理和注册机制 :Platform_device 和 Platform_driver 。 Linux 中大部分的设备驱动,都可以使用这套机制 , 设备用 Platform_device 表示,驱动用 Platform_driver 进行注册。 L...
转载 2014-08-29 18:20:00
71阅读
从 Linux 2.6 起引入了一套新的驱动管理和注册机制 :Platform_device 和 Platform_driver 。 Linux 中大部分的设备驱动,都可以使用这套机制 , 设备用 Platform_device 表示,驱动用 Platform_driver 进行注册。 L...
原创 2021-12-21 16:24:50
399阅读
Linux设备驱动程序是Linux系统中一个非常重要的组件,其作用是将系统内核和硬件设备之间进行通信和交互。红帽作为一个知名的Linux发行版,自然也涉及到Linux设备驱动程序的开发和管理。本文将探讨Linux设备驱动程序与红帽之间的关系。 首先,红帽作为一个专业的Linux发行版,其内核与Linux内核有着密切的联系。Linux内核的源代码中包含了大量的设备驱动程序,这些驱动程序负责管理各种
原创 2024-03-26 09:45:43
58阅读
转自MSDNYou can use the following guidelines to either verify that your device is installed correctly or diagnose problems with your device installation:Follow the steps that are described in
转载 2022-11-07 19:04:23
60阅读
Linux Device Driver 3 (LDD3) is a comprehensive guide that provides practical examples and detailed explanations of how to develop device drivers for the Linux kernel. It covers a wide range of topics
原创 2024-03-27 11:05:16
65阅读
在Linux系统中,对于硬件设备的驱动程序通常可以分为两种类型:driverdevice。那么,这两者之间到底有什么区别呢? 首先,我们需要明确的是driverdevice是两个完全不同的概念。Driver(驱动程序)是用来与硬件设备进行通信的软件模块,它负责控制设备的操作,并提供给操作系统一个接口,使得操作系统可以访问设备并进行操作。而device(设备)则是物理实体,例如键盘、鼠标、打印
原创 2024-03-28 09:44:53
409阅读
Linux Device Driver && Device File
原创 2023-07-21 10:16:36
50阅读
系统调优① Nproc:单个用户同一时刻可用的最大进程数量② Ulimit:单个用户同时打开的最大文件数,调整ulimit上限 修改limits.conf文件,执行ulimit -a命令可以检查这个文件的内容。③ 禁用JVM的自适应堆大小,固定堆内存的上下限④ 启用JVM重用,可以设置mapred.job.reuse.jvm.num.tasks参数为我们想重用的JVM的个数⑤ atime和noa
转载 2024-05-17 15:50:40
127阅读
在前一个例子SharedSection中,我们共享内存区通讯。这个驱动紧紧关联到用户模式进程的地址空间,也就是驱动所用的虚拟地址在进程空间地址中。这个例子中我们用的这个方法,没有这个缺点,对于驱动来说这个方法更适合。 9.1 SharingMemory驱动的源码 首先,驱动的功能。 ;@echo off ;goto make ;::::::::::::::::::::::::::::::::
1. 前言 devicedevice driver是Linux驱动开发的基本概念。Linux kernel的思路很简单:驱动开发,就是要开发指定的软件(driver)以驱动指定的设备,所以kernel就为设备和驱动它的driver定义了两个数据结构,分别是devicedevice_driver
转载 2016-12-10 16:34:00
140阅读
2评论
一、定义:struct device_driver结构体被定义在/include/linux/device.h,原型是: 124struct device_driver { 125 const char * name; 126 struct bus_type * bus; 127 128 struct kobject kobj; 129 struct klist klist_devices; 130 struct klist_node ...
转载 2010-09-20 10:37:00
375阅读
2评论
strace 命令是一个有力工具, 显示所有的用户空间程序发出的系统调用. 它不仅显示调用, 还以符号形式显示调用的参数和返回值. 当一个系统调用失败, 错误的符号值(例如, ENOMEM)和对应的字串(Out of memory) 都显示. strace 有很多命令行选项; 其中最有用的是 -t 来显示每个调用执行的时间, -T 来显示调用中花费的时间, -e 来限制被跟踪调用的类型, 以及-o
原创 2021-07-27 22:01:01
372阅读
  • 1
  • 2
  • 3
  • 4
  • 5